HISTORY: Devil’s Claw is native to South Africa and East Africa. It is an herbaceous perennial, growing to 1.5m or 5 ft. in length, whose brilliant ‘devil’ red/purple flowers and woody barbed, claw-like fruit are credited for its descriptive name. Decoctions of dried roots have long been taken as a tea or a tonic by the indigenous peoples of many African countries for a variety of digestive and rheumatic conditions. After Devil’s Claw was introduced to European herbal medicine, this herb became so popular that by 1976 it was estimated 30,000 arthritic patients in the United Kingdom alone were using it.
PRODUCT DESCRIPTION: Devil’s Claw is primarily used in the management of inflammatory joint diseases, such as osteo-arthritis, rheumatoid arthritis and gout. Since Devil’s Claw is considered to be a ‘bitter tonic’ it may be of help in the management of various gastrointestinal complaints including dyspepsia and digestive upsets.
